brandtjohnd wrote:My 89 has the compass/temp module. It would come on, but it was very very dim and the data (direction/Temp) were not correct. I found a person on ebay that repairs the overhead console module. He charges 55 bucks and gets it working.
Search ebay for "rofflesaurrrr" as the user or "91-96 Jeep Cherokee XJ Overhead Console Computer/PCB Repair Service" as the description.
